I went for a brunch in a weekend and it seems that the menu in the weekend is different than weekdays. The place is nicely decorated, cosy and neat (rating 5). The staff are extremely friendly, helpful and professional (rating 5). The food menu includes a choice of baked omelette that is small but comes with 6 small bowls of: honey cream, feta walnut, apricot jam, olives, cold cut beef, cucumber and tomatoes. Food is yummy but nothing extraordinary, pita bread made in the oven and is really good (rating 5). Definitely recommended.
